    That photo wasn't really taken specifically for a wiring diagram, it was simply the closest I had. Basically, the red wire on the top side of the board is your speaker and battery positive. Both of those will need to be connected to this wire. The brown one is the speaker negative. The black is the battery pack negative. The color of the wires that are covered by the heat shrink tubing doesn't really matter, as those will be provided by you, when you make your own battery pack.
